  1. Automotive Sector

The seals, gaskets, bushings, and vibration mounts are necessary for vehicle reliability. The electric vehicle has created new demand for special battery seals. The automotive clients need high-volume orders with extremely tight tolerance requirements. The pressure to reduce weight and maintain durability for innovation. Many manufacturers must balance cost efficiency with the precise specifications needed for modern vehicles.

 

  1. Medical & Healthcare

The FDA-grade silicone molds for implants need to function properly for years. The surgical tool grips and tube connectors require the exact precision and reliability. The production must meet strict cleanroom standards to ensure patient safety. The stakes are incredibly high when human health depends on perfect parts. The industry can't handle any imperfection.

 

  1. Aerospace & Defense

The heat-resistant molds produce critical jet components that withstand extreme conditions. Fuel system seals and cabin pressure components face rigorous testing protocols. The rubber mold manufacturers must comply with the strict requirements of AS9100 certification. Their parts must perform reliably at high altitudes and in various temperature changes. 

 

  1. Electronics & Consumer Goods

The keypads, protective covers, and cable grommets protect sensitive electronic components. This sector often requires small batch runs with incredibly fast design cycles. The products must appeal visually and deliver consistent performance over thousands of uses.

 

  1. Construction & Industrial

The pipe seals, HVAC gaskets, and machinery mounts form industrial infrastructure. Many companies order these components in bulk for outdoor durability. The cost-effective tooling eases the pricing pressures. The rubber parts manufacturer must deliver reliability under harsh conditions.

  1. Flexible Tooling & Rapid Prototyping

The advanced CAD/CAM software speeds up the mold design process. Many companies now create 3D-printed prototypes that cut lead times nearly in half. Modular mold bases allow quick swaps between production runs for efficiency. The same core tool can be adapted for varied parts to reduce costs. Soft tooling is the best for low-volume test runs before committing resources. The hard steel molds come later for mass production.

 

Modern rubber mold manufacturers invest in rapid development technologies. Their approach saves clients substantial money during product development phases. Many flexible systems enable fast changes in the event of a specification change. This is useful in startups whose designs keep changing. 

 

  1. Precision Engineering for Tight Tolerances

The machining will be done by CNC which means that thousands of identical pieces will be accurate. Most EDM processes produce complex shapes of cavities that cannot be gained using conventional processes.  The multi-cavity molds boost output per cycle for improved production efficiency. 

 

The manufacturers do careful venting and parting line design to reduce flash for cleaner results. The in-house quality control with advanced measuring equipment catches issues early. The first article inspection becomes standard practice for building trust with new clients.

 

The rubber moulds manufacturing evolves over the years of experience. The technicians are aware of the way in which various compounds move and cure in diverse environments. This assists in predicting and preventing typical molding faults in advance. The temperature control systems ensure the ideal conditions during production runs.
